All set for Mills' thanksgiving service

A thanksgiving service in honor of late President Mills is scheduled to come off on Sunday in the Central regional capital, Cape-Coast.

The ceremony is expected to be graced by Vice President, Paa Kwesi Ammisah Arthur together with other top government officials.

The service comes two days after the late President was laid to rest at the Asmdwee Park here in Accra.

The family of the late President had requested for a private thanksgiving service that would be held at the Wesley Methodist Church at the Chapel Square in Cape Coast.

In a related development the committee that planned the funeral of President Mills has expressed its appreciation to all Ghanaians for the immense participation and show of love during the three day funeral ceremony.

The burial ceremony on Friday had an estimated 50 thousand participants and the preceding two day ceremony for people to pay their last respects had thousands more.
